Community Bancorp. (OTCMKTS:CMTV) Director David Mark Bouffard Acquires 500 Shares

Community Bancorp. (OTCMKTS:CMTV - Get Free Report) Director David Mark Bouffard purchased 500 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, February 4th. The stock was acquired at an average cost of $31.45 per share, with a total value of $15,725.00. Following the transaction, the director directly owned 6,736 shares in the company, valued at approximately $211,847.20. This trade represents a 8.02% increase in their position. The acquisition was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is available at this hyperlink.

Community Bancorp. (OTCMKTS:CMTV -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, January 27th. The financial services provider reported $0.83 earnings per share for the quarter. Community Bancorp. had a return on equity of 16.08% and a net margin of 24.67%.The business had revenue of $13.21 million during the quarter.

Community Bancorp. Company Profile

Community Bancorp. operates as the bank holding company for Community National Bank that provides financial services to individuals, businesses, nonprofit organizations, and municipalities in northern and central Vermont. It offers financing for commercial business properties, equipment, inventories, and accounts receivable, as well as standby letters of credit; and business checking and other deposit accounts, cash management services, repurchase agreements, ACH and wire transfer services, card processing, and remote deposit capture.
